1.Such associations shall pay the same fees for annual reports and annual certificates of authority as are required to be paid by domestic companies organized and doing business under chapter 515, which certificates shall expire June 1 of the year following the date of issue.
2.A certificate of authority of an association formed under this chapter shall be renewed §518A.40, STATE MUTUAL INSURANCE ASSOCIATIONS 10 annually so long as the organization transacts its business in accordance with all legal requirements. Such an association shall submit annually, on or before March 1, a completed application for renewal of its certificate of authority.
